I got an FP on this rule in some email from a company named something Financial
with a line like "Soandso Financial is committed to ..."

I would just go ahead and change the rule to not match anything beginning with
financial, but I'm not enough of a perl regexp expert to be confident of what
the cleanest way to do it is. The rule already begins with /(?!CIALIS)C to not
match a non-fuzzy CIALIS. What would be the right way to also exclude
FINANCIAL?
